  • Abstract
    Aiming at the current methods´ problems of single information source and high cost a vehicle information monitoring system based on MPT (Mobile Phone Terminal) is proposed, and MPT acts as the monitoring carrier. In the system, Multi-Source Information is used, and dedicated information exchange protocol is designed and used to exchange data. Bluetooth and sensor technology are used to achieve the real-time monitoring of the vehicle driving data and on-demand fault detection. Using GPRS, the system sends data to RSC (Remote Service Centre), and requests remote services from RSC. Experiments show that the system is effective, real time, easy installation, and low cost.
